If there is no sound when you expect it or the
volume is too low or high, try the following solutions:
-
Adjust the
projector's volume settings.
-
Press the
A/V Mute button on the remote
control to resume video and audio if they were temporarily
stopped.
-
Press the
Source Search or Search button to switch to the correct input
source, if necessary.
-
Check your
computer or video source to make sure the volume is turned up and
the audio output is set for the correct source.
-
Check the
audio cable connections between the projector and your video
source.
-
If you do
not hear sound from an HDMI source, set the connected device to PCM
output.
-
Make sure
any connected audio cables are labeled "No Resistance".
-
If you are
using a Mac and you do not hear sound from an HDMI source, make
sure your Mac supports audio through the HDMI port. If not, you
need to connect an audio cable.
-
If you
want to use a connected audio source when the projector is off, set
the Standby Mode option to
Communication On and make sure the
A/V Settings options are set
correctly.
-
You must
connect external speakers to the projector to hear sound
(PowerLite Pro G6800/G6900WU).
-
If you
turn the projector on immediately after turning it off, the cooling
fans may run at high speed momentarily and cause an unexpected
noise. This is normal.
